Gabe Cabrera
Salty’s on Redondo

Gabriel Cabrera is the Executive Chef for Salty's at Redondo. Gabriel came to Salty's with 26 years' experience as an executive chef in the food industry. Chef Cabrera holds an Associate degree from South Seattle Community College in Hospitality and Food Management. Before arriving at Salty's he held an executive sous chef position at Palisade restaurant in Seattle under Executive chef John Howie. It was there that Cabrera perfected his Plank Cooking and designed many original recipes. Cabrera was also an executive chef at C.I.Shenanigans and the Marriott Hotel at Sea Tac. With determination and talent, he worked through all the ranks at the Marriott Hotel and then followed this experience by owning his own restaurant called Hungry Herbert. Chef Cabrera hails from Mexico City where he belongs to a large family of restaurateurs. He married his first and only sweetheart, whom he met as an exchange student while staying in her home. This home was right in Redondo Beach and now he is working right back in the neighborhood of his fondest memories. Known as “Chef Gabe" Cabrera has a following for his Market Sheet Specials at Redondo Beach. He is often asked to talk about them on radio and demonstrate them at special events such as Cooking with Class, where each year he receives a standing ovation for his tasty dishes. He was recently featured in Colors NW Magazine in a story titled “Recipe for Success, chefs at the help of top local restaurants.” He was also chosen to cook on air for the popular KCTS-TV Viewer’s Cook show. His recipes are included in many of their Viewer’s and Chef’s cook Series. Gabe Cabrera is an outstanding culinary professional, appreciated by his staff and adored by his guests. He brings maturity and dedication to the Salty’s team.
